FamilyDid You Play With These Cowboy And Indians Soldiers Toys In The 80's? by Redman44(op): 2:54am On Sep 16, 2018
I played with these Cowboys and Indian Toys when I was in Primary School in the 80's. I used to buy them for 30 kobo to 50 kobo per piece then from those women that sold household goods in their Shops cheesy cheesy cheesy cheesy cheesy. I had loads of them and I played with them by placing them on a table on our verandah and banging on the table softly to make them move. I considered the ones that fell down dead in the heat of battle. Did you play with these Cowboy and Indian warriors and soldiers toys too? CareerRe: I Want To Choose A Career In Journalism by Redman44(m): 9:18am On Sep 10, 2018
Christmasdon:
what's the difference between Frcn and NIJ?
FRCN is the Federal Radio Corporation of Nigeria. FRCN owns and operates the Radio Nigeria Stations ( I hope Radio Nigeria 2 etc are still existing ). FRCN's headquarters is located in Ikoyi, Lagos. FRCN has a training school. My brother attended FRCN's training school and obtained a Certificate from the place. FRCN should have courses in Radio broadcasting, Radio Management and Production and associated Courses like Advertising and Public Relations. Use Google to find out more about the FRCN Training School.

The Nigerian Institute of Journalism ( NIJ ) is an accredited Institution that offers Courses in Journalism, Public Relations, Advertising, Broadcasting ( I heard NIJ now has good quality broadcasting facilities ), Marketing etc. They have these Courses at Ordinary Diploma and HND levels. I think they also have Postgraduate Diploma Courses at NIJ. NIJ is more of a private institution, but it is recognized by all the Media outlets in Nigeria. NIJ Certificates are respected in Nigeria and other parts of the World, especially Africa. NIJ prepares you to be independent in nature and self sustaining. After graduating from NIJ, you should be able to start your own Media Organization on a small scale. I attended NIJ, so I know what I am saying. Studying Journalism exposes you to a lot of things. Journalism can be lucrative if you know how to go about it. Stay Blessed.
CareerRe: I Want To Choose A Career In Journalism by Redman44(m): 8:42am On Sep 10, 2018
I attended the Nigerian Institute of Journalism ( NIJ ) and I have a Diploma in Journalism from the Institution. Honestly, Print Journalism is on the decline all over the World. You can still study Broadcasting as a Course, if you intend to work in a Television or Radio Station as a Newscaster, Continuity Announcer or Production Assistant. Due to the advent of the Internet, sales of Newspapers and Magazines have fallen drastically all over the World, especially in Asia and Africa. However, if you can design a good news website that provides specific information to a sector of the society, you will make good money. Something like Agriculture News, Education News or devoting your website to reporting about Basketball in Nigeria. You have to write about a Niche, not general news. You can start a Website that will provide feature stories about the Catering Industry in Nigeria, which is blossoming at the moment. People are venturing into making snacks, cakes etc. You can publish a Magazine online that will provide information specifically for the Catering Industry in Nigeria and ask people to subscribe to the Magazine online and also print like 1000 copies of the Magazine monthly.

You can attend NIJ, My brother. It is a very good journalism school. I have not regretted attending the Institution which is now a accredited Journalism School. Cheers.
